(2025·铜仁模拟)Museums have changed. Nowadays you'll find a museum for absolutely everything and everyone. These collections are odd, wonderful and worth a visit.
Museum of Bad Art
Boston, Massachusetts
The mission of MOBA is to collect, exhibit and celebrate art that will be shown in no other venue. The museum's new location, in the Dorchester Brewing Co., assumes visitors would need a drink after seeing this work. Highlights include Lucy in the Field with Flowers, a painting found in 1993 leaning against a trash barrel, waiting for garbage collection.
International Tennis Hall of Fame
Newport, Rhode Island
The International Tennis Hall of Fame was built on the site of the first United States National Lawn Tennis Championships in 1881. A highlight is a King Court for "court tennis", first played by monks and kings dating back to 1538. There are only 10 such courts in North America, as they cost approximately $3 million to make, but visitors to the museum can rent it and play.
National Comedy Center
Jamestown, New York
Based in Lucille Ball's hometown, this museum features exhibits such as Jerry Seinfeld's puffy shirt and Joan Rivers's card catalog of 65,000 jokes. Before entering, visitors choose what they find funny, and the data is collected on a digital chip they wear on a wrist so that the comedy content is customized based on their personal taste.
Spam Museum
Austin, Minnesota
Dedicated only to the much-mocked brand of precooked meat, this free 14, 000 - square-foot museum tells the history of the Hormel company, the originator of Spam, and its mark on the world. Highlights include Monty Python's famous "Spam" sketch and free "samples" given out by volunteer guides.

(2025·铜仁模拟)I have been passionate about public welfare since childhood, but I never imagined that a Chinese figure named Lei Feng would become an integral part of my life — my guiding star and the inspiration behind a global movement.
In 2018, I came to China for the first time to study at Jiangxi University of Finance and Economics (JUFE) and actively participated in the university's public welfare activities. During these events, local people often called me "Yang Lei Feng", which I later learned means "foreign Lei Feng".
Curious, I looked him up online and discovered a young soldier known for his selflessness and dedication to helping others. The more I read, the more I saw how his values aligned with the principles I aspired to uphold.
Inspired by Lei Feng's spirit, I established the Lei Feng International Volunteer Association on March 5, 2021 — Lei Feng Day — alongside young people from different countries at JUFE. Our mission is to support children with special needs, assist the elderly, promote environmental awareness, empower through education, and foster cross-cultural understanding. Through these efforts, we continue to keep Lei Feng's spirit alive in a modern, global context.
On Lei Feng Day in 2025, I took a bold step to spread his legacy beyond China by launching the global "Learn from Lei Feng" campaign. We celebrated the day in five countries — Bangladesh, Ghana, Kenya, Algeria, and China — through discussions on his biography,charity programs, and community service activities.
What began as a vision to promote his values internationally has since grown into a global movement, now spanning 15 countries. Our efforts not only strengthen cross-cultural bonds but also contribute to building a more compassionate and service-oriented world.
For me, this campaign represents a full-circle moment. From discovering Lei Feng's story online to now inspiring future generations to follow in his footsteps, I am reminded of how one person's story can spark a movement.

(2025·铜仁模拟)Each year, the world loses about 10 million hectares of forest — an area about the size of Iceland because of cutting down trees. At that rate, some scientists predict the world's forests could disappear in 100 to 200 years. To handle it, now researchers at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) have pioneered a technique to generate wood-like plant materials in a lab. This makes it possible to "grow" a wooden product without cutting down trees.
In the lab, the researchers first take cells from the leaves of a young plant. These cells are cultured in liquid medium for two days, then moved to another medium which contains nutrients and two different hormones (激素). By adjusting the hormone levels, the researchers can tune the physical and mechanical qualities of the cells. Next, the researchers use a 3D printer to shape the cell-based material, and let the shaped material grow in the dark for three months. Finally, the researchers dehydrate (使脱水) the material, and then evaluate its qualities.
They found that lower hormone levels lead to plant materials with more rounded, open cells of lower density (密度), while higher hormone levels contribute to the growth of plant materials with smaller but denser cell structures. Lower or higher density of cell structures makes the plant materials flexible, helping the materials grow with different wood-like characteristics. What's more, it's to be noted that the research process is about 100 times faster than the time it takes for a tree to grow to maturity!
Research of this kind is ground-breaking. "This work demonstrates the great power of a technology," says lead researcher, Jeffrey Berenstain. "The real opportunity here is to be at its best with what you use and how you use it. This technology can be tuned to meet the requirements you give about shapes, sizes, flexibility, and forms. It enables us to ‘grow' any wooden product in a way that traditional agricultural methods can't achieve."

(2025·铜仁模拟)Researchers at University College London found that boys in year 5 and year 9 in England scored significantly higher than girls in maths and science in recent international assessments. Dr Jennie Golding, of UCL's Institute of Education and the co-principal investigator of the research said, "It is difficult to say exactly why this gap has opened up but our findings point to some factors including confidence and socioeconomic status."
The improvement by boys was particularly noticeable in maths, where the data analysis found that greater confidence was strongly associated with higher scores in the quadrennial tests conducted for the Trends in International Mathematics and Science Study (TIMSS).
Across both year groups in maths and in year 9 science, the researchers found that significantly higher percentages of boys reported being very confident on statements related to maths and science, while a large percentage of girls said they were not confident. In year 9 maths, 21% of boys and 9% of girls reported they were very confident, while 38% of boys and 60% of girls reported they were not confident. In 2024, boys consistently outperformed girls at both grades in maths, physics, economics and statistics.
TIMSS uses the number of books at home as an index (指标) for socioeconomic status. Stubborn gaps remain between disadvantaged pupils and their better-off peers. The researchers found a significant gap between pupils who had access to a large number of books at home and those who did not. In year 9 science, pupils in households with fewer than ten books at home scored 461, compared to 601 for those in households with over 200 books at home.
"Those who have fewer educational resources at home need extra funds in order to access the same opportunities to learn compared with their better-resourced peers," said Prof Mary Richardson, the study's co-principal investigator.
